We don't load any bootstrap.min.js file on your site. We do use a file called jq-bootstrap-1.8.3.js, which has a specialized version of jQuery and Bootstrap that's specific to JFBConnect. You can disable the loading of that file with the "Include jQuery / Bootstrap" setting in our Configuration area. However, only do that if you are already loading jQuery and Bootstrap into the page on your own.
Our specialized versions of those files are setup in a way that is invisible to other extensions, so that it can run alongside them without causing conflicts. I'd be surprised if that file is what's causing your issues, but let us know if so.
